Compartir a través de


Método IMbnVendorSpecificOperation::SetVendorSpecific (mbnapi.h)

Importante

A partir de Windows 10, versión 1803, las API de Win32 descritas en esta sección se reemplazan por las API de Windows Runtime en el espacio de nombres Windows.Networking.Connectivity.

Envía una solicitud al controlador de minipuerto del dispositivo de banda ancha móvil subyacente.

Sintaxis

HRESULT SetVendorSpecific(
  [in]  SAFEARRAY *vendorSpecificData,
  [out] ULONG     *requestID
);

Parámetros

[in] vendorSpecificData

Matriz de bytes que se pasa al controlador de minipuerto.

[out] requestID

Identificador de solicitud único asignado por el servicio de banda ancha móvil para identificar esta solicitud.

Valor devuelto

Si este método se realiza correctamente, devuelve S_OK. De lo contrario, devuelve un código de error de HRESULT.

Comentarios

SetVendorSpecific existe para implementar la funcionalidad específica del proveedor que no se trata en la API de banda ancha móvil.

El servicio de banda ancha móvil emitirá una solicitud SET OID al controlador de minipuerto subyacente para OID_WWAN_VENDOR_SPECIFIC OID. VendorspecificData se copiará byte byte en el búfer de datos pasado en la solicitud de OID.

Se trata de una operación asincrónica y SetVendorSpecific se devolverá inmediatamente. Al finalizar la operación, el servicio de banda ancha móvil llamará al método OnSetVendorSpecificComplete de la interfaz IMbnVendorSpecificEvents .

Consulte el modelo de controlador de banda ancha móvil para obtener más información sobre las operaciones específicas del proveedor.

Requisitos

Requisito Value
Cliente mínimo compatible Windows 7 [solo aplicaciones de escritorio]
Servidor mínimo compatible No se admite ninguno
Plataforma de destino Windows
Encabezado mbnapi.h

Consulte también

IMbnVendorSpecificOperation